Understanding the Heat Exchanger (Heat Exchanger)

In the ever-evolving world of industrial machinery, few devices are as pivotal as the heat exchanger, or as we say in Mandarin, Heat Exchanger. This wonder of engineering plays a crucial role in transferring heat between two or more fluids, making it indispensable in various sectors, from power generation to petrochemicals.

How Does It Work?

At its core, the heat exchanger operates on a simple principle: heat transfer. Picture this: You've got hot fluid flowing through one side and cold fluid on the other. As they pass each other, heat moves from the hot to the cold, efficiently cooling one and heating the other. It's like a dance between temperatures, and the heat exchanger is the stage!

Types of Heat Exchangers

There are various types of heat exchangers, each tailored to specific applications. Here's a quick rundown:

  • Shell and Tube: Think of these as the classic duo. They consist of a series of tubes, with one fluid running through the tubes and another flowing around them. Great for high-pressure applications!
  • Plate Heat Exchangers: These are modern marvels, made up of thin plates that create a large surface area for heat transfer. They're compact and efficient, making them a favorite in food processing.
  • Air-Cooled Heat Exchangers: Perfect for situations where water is scarce. They use air to cool the fluid, ideal for outdoor applications.

Applications Across Industries

So, where can you find these nifty devices? The applications are nearly endless:

  • Power Plants: They help in cooling steam back into water, ensuring efficient energy production.
  • HVAC Systems: Maintaining comfortable indoor climates is made possible thanks to heat exchangers.
  • Oil Refineries: They play a critical role in cooling and heating various fluids during the refining process.

Benefits of Using Heat Exchangers

Now, let's talk benefits. Why should industries consider integrating the heat exchanger into their systems? Here are a few reasons:

  • Energy Efficiency: By recovering waste heat, businesses can significantly reduce energy consumption.
  • Cost Savings: Lower energy bills mean more money in the bank. It's a win-win!
  • Environmental Impact: Reducing energy usage also lowers emissions, helping industries go green.
